
Women’s Tennis to Compete at ITA Southern Regional Championships
10/9/2024 9:10:00 AM | Women's Tennis
Four UA student-athletes will represent the Crimson Tide during the tournament
TUSCALOOSA, Ala. – The Alabama women's tennis team will travel to Auburn, Ala., for the ITA Southern Regional Championships. The competition will run from Oct. 10-15 at the Yarbrough Tennis Center.
The Crimson Tide will have Sara Nayar, Priya Nelson, Klara Milicevic and Ansley Cheshire competing over the five days. Cheshire will begin competition on Thursday, Oct. 10 in the qualifying draw, while the remaining UA players start in the main draw on Friday.

About the Tide
- Alabama started the fall season strong, picking up four singles wins and two doubles wins at the Debbie Southern Fall Classic
- Klara Milicevic recorded her first win of the season after defeating Clemson's Annabelle Davis (6-3, 6-2) during the Debbie Southern Fall Classic
- Sara Nayar will look to earn her first victory with the Tide
- Ansley Cheshire and Priya Nelson are competing for the first time this season
ITA All Southern Regional Championship
- Alabama will face players from 15 teams at the ITA Southern Regional
- UA will face players from Auburn, Jacksonville State, Louisiana Lafayette, Louisiana Monroe, Louisiana Tech, LSU, McNeese State, Mississippi State, Ole Miss, Samford, South Alabama, Southern Miss, UAB, Troy and Tulane
